Copenhagen hold Porto to 1-1 draw
By Philip O'Connor (Reuters) - A second-half header by Andreas Cornelius gave visitors FC Copenhagen a share of the spoils as they drew 1-1 with Porto in their opening Group G Champions League clash on Wednesday. The home side went ahead in the 13th minute when Otavio Edmilson dispossessed Copenhagen midfielder Thomas Delaney on the edge of his penalty area before playing a quick one-two with Andre Silva and rifling home the ball. Italian TV station suspends ties with Di Canio over fascist tattoo
Sky Italia television station has suspended its ties with former Lazio and West Ham striker Paolo Di Canio after he presented a show wearing a T-shirt that showed he had a tattoo celebrating former Fascist leader Benito Mussolini. Di Canio had his own weekly programme on Sky Italia, a unit of Sky Plc, to discuss the English premier league, but sparked controversy on Sunday when he appeared with bare arms, with the word "Dux" inked large on his right forearm. Comcast's NBCU books $250 million in profit from Rio Olympics coverage
(Reuters) - NBC Universal, a unit of Comcast Corp, said the company booked more than $250 million in profit from the Rio Olympics coverage, helped by strong advertising sales. Advertising sales rose more than 20 percent to $1.2 billion, compared with the 2012 London Olympics, NBC Universal Chief Executive Steve Burke said on Wednesday. Despite a drop in viewership, NBC had said in August that it could top the $120 million profit that it had recorded from the 2012 Olympics coverage. -
